How to start investing, camping with kids and is lockdown making our kids anti-social?

Today we’re joined by Canna Campbell – best-selling author of The $1000 Project and founder of financial media platform, SugarMamma.TV, as part of family finance month on Kidspot. Canna is here to talk us through investing for the first time and what we need to know. Our new regular contributor Evie Farrell is with us to talk about why she’s discovered the joy of camping with kids. And Sarah is enjoying the peace of lockdown but wonders whether it’s making our kids anti-social.
